pipe saddle

I wish to create a contoured pipe end (as attachment). Easy to do in autocad 3d but inventor do you use the sheet metal option or is there a provision for cut to remove the unwanted top section of pipe to suit the desired profile.Would this be done in the sketch phase or model phase using additional sketch features.

Any suggestions would be appreciated.

I would create the pipe as normal (either a revolution or sweep) and then cut away the end by using an extrusion from a sketch.  See the attached part (Iv2014) - I've revolved the pipe and on the same sketch I've drawing a circle to cut away the end.

 

Hope that makes sense.
